What is bitcoin teknik analiz?
Bitcoin teknik analiz, or Bitcoin technical analysis, is the study of historical price and volume data to forecast future Bitcoin price movements.
Instead of focusing on news or fundamentals, teknik analiz uses charts, indicators, and patterns to identify trends and potential entry or exit points. For beginners, it provides a structured way to make trading decisions without relying on emotions.
How to do bitcoin teknik analiz for beginners?
Beginners can start Bitcoin teknik analiz by learning to read candlestick charts and identifying basic support and resistance levels.
Steps to get started:
- Choose a trading platform with charting tools (e.g., TradingView, Binance).
- Study candlestick patterns like doji, hammer, and engulfing.
- Add simple indicators such as moving averages and RSI.
- Practice on a demo account before using real funds.
Focus on one or two indicators first to avoid confusion.

What are the best indicators for bitcoin teknik analiz?
The best indicators for Bitcoin teknik analiz typically include moving averages, RSI, MACD, and Bollinger Bands.
Popular choices:
- Moving averages (SMA/EMA) – identify trend direction and support/resistance.
- RSI – shows overbought or oversold conditions.
- MACD – signals trend reversals and momentum.
- Bollinger Bands – measure volatility and potential breakouts.
No single indicator is best; combining them improves accuracy.
Bitcoin teknik analiz vs fundamental analysis: which is better?
Neither is categorically better; Bitcoin teknik analiz focuses on price action, while fundamental analysis evaluates the asset's underlying value and network health.
Technical analysis is better for short-term trading, while fundamentals help long-term investors. Many successful traders use both: fundamentals to choose the asset, and teknik analiz to time trades.

What are the pros and cons of bitcoin teknik analiz?
The main pros of Bitcoin teknik analiz are its objectivity and applicability to any time frame, while the cons include subjectivity in pattern interpretation and false signals.
Pros:
- Can be used for day trading or swing trading.
- Provides clear entry/exit rules.
- Works across different exchanges.
Cons:
- Signals can lag or produce false breakouts.
- Requires continuous learning and discipline.
- Does not account for unexpected news or hacks.
How to read Bitcoin candlestick charts for teknik analiz?
Reading Bitcoin candlestick charts involves analysing the open, high, low, and close prices within a selected time period.
Each candle has a body and wicks; a green/white body means price rose, and a red/black body means price fell. Patterns like a long lower wick (hammer) often signal reversals. Combine candles with support/resistance levels to improve your Bitcoin teknik analiz.
